Yeah crows can be annoying. But they and other birds such as buzzards are necessary to the environment as they clean up the road kill. Now, when I was growing up in the 50's there were very few crows , hawks and buzzards because they were being wiped out by DDT. DDT made their eggs soft and they were rapidly diminishing. So when I see a crow today I am thankful that those species weren't eliminated altogether. History lesson over!:lol: :wave:
